Message type: E = Error
Message class: RSM2 - Monitor assistant help texts
Message number: 205
Message text: Variant &1 already exists for a deletion run. Insert a new variant.

- Variant &1 already exists for a deletion run. Insert a new variant. ?The SAP error message RSM2205 indicates that you are trying to create a variant for a deletion run that already exists. This typically occurs in the context of SAP's data archiving or data deletion processes, where variants are used to define specific criteria for the deletion run.
Cause:
The error occurs because:
- You are attempting to create a new variant with the same name or identifier as an existing one.
- The system does not allow duplicate variants for deletion runs to prevent confusion and ensure data integrity.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:
Check Existing Variants:
- Go to the transaction where you are trying to create the variant (e.g., SARA for archiving).
- Look for the existing variants that match the name you are trying to use. You can usually find this in the variant management section.
Use a Different Name:
- If you find that a variant with the same name already exists, consider using a different name for your new variant. This will allow you to create a new variant without conflicts.
Modify or Delete Existing Variant:
- If the existing variant is no longer needed, you can delete it or modify it to suit your current requirements. Be cautious with deletion, as it may affect other processes relying on that variant.
Consult Documentation:
- Review SAP documentation or help files related to the specific transaction you are using. This can provide additional context on how variants are managed.
Check User Permissions:
- Ensure that you have the necessary permissions to create or modify variants. Sometimes, restrictions can lead to unexpected errors.
